Orthographic Projection and Its Applications

Orthographic projection is one of the core subjects taught in engineering graphics. It represents 3D objects in two dimensions using multiple views such as front, top, and side. Dimensioning and Tolerancing

No engineering drawing is complete without proper dimensioning and tolerancing. These techniques define the size, shape, and allowable variation of manufactured parts. The book introduces learners to GD&T principles, such as flatness, perpendicularity, concentricity, and surface finish. With AutoCAD, these tolerances can be applied directly to drawings using specialized annotation tools. This ensures that a part designed in one location can be manufactured and assembled correctly in another, reducing errors and ensuring global compatibility.

Sectional Views for Clarity

Complex objects often require sectional views to reveal hidden features. The Engineering Graphics Essentials With AutoCAD 2014 Instruction PDF For Free provides extensive coverage of sectional views, including full sections, half sections, and offset sections. Students learn how to cut through objects virtually and display interior features with accuracy. AutoCAD supports this through hatch patterns, line weights, and cutting plane symbols, enabling students to create professional-quality drawings.

Standards and Conventions in Engineering Graphics

Adhering to global drawing standards is crucial in professional practice. The book emphasizes compliance with ANSI Y14.5, ISO 5459, ISO 1101, and ASME Y14 standards. These conventions govern aspects such as line types, lettering, dimension placement, and geometric tolerances. Using AutoCAD, students can apply these rules consistently through template files and layer management. Understanding and applying standards prevents misinterpretations and ensures that designs meet industry expectations.
